Yoga Thrive Helps Cancer Patients Heal

Yoga Thrive is a community-based program for cancer survivors that was started by Dr. Nicole Culos-Reed of the University of Calgary and yoga instructor Susi Hately. The seven-week program offers free or minimally-priced therapeutic yoga classes to patients and loved ones in any stage of treatment.
